Jobs /

Software Dev Engineer I

Expedia

Apply Now

Job Details

Location: Shenzhen, Guangdong, China Posted: Jun 20, 2019

Job Description

Expedia

Software Development Engineer - I

Expedia Group is the world’s travel platform. We are among the largest technology companies in the world. We create the tools and technology to help millions of travelers around the world search and book their perfect trip - from flights to activities, accommodations to cars, our tools cover it all.

Expedia Group’s Partner Central team is looking for an individual who is passionate about technology, user experience and the web application development. In this position, you will join an agile team of software engineers to create fast, engaging and scalable web applications. You will take ownership of the work streams in your team, initiate innovative solutions, and collaborate with our global technology teams.

What you’ll do:

  • Develop, debug, and modify components of software applications and tools
  • Communicate and work effectively with global technology teams
  • Write automated unit, integration and acceptance tests as appropriate to support our continuous integration pipelines
  • Support and troubleshoot data and/or system issues as needed
  • Resolve problems and roadblocks as they occur with help from peers or managers. Follow through on details and drive issues to closure
  • Participate in code reviews to assess overall code quality and flexibility
  • Define, develop and maintain artifacts like technical design or partner documentation
  • Participate in user story creation in collaboration with the team

Who you are:

  • 1 - 3+ years of experience in Software Engineering
  • Solid experience in Java and web technologies
  • Solid experience with REST APIs or distributed RPC technologies
  • Experience in using Java development frameworks and tools: Spring MVC, Spring Boot, Apache Tomcat, Gradle and Maven
  • Effective English verbal and written communication skills with the ability to present complex technical information clearly and concisely
  • Understanding of the software development life cycle, architecture and design pattern
  • Experience using code versioning tools for e.g. Git or others
  • Experience in Agile/Scrum software development practices
  • Bachelors or master’s degree in computer science or a related major and/or equivalent work experience
  • Familiar with AWS Cloud technologies: EC2, S3, and SQS will be a strong plus.

Why join us:

Expedia Group recognizes our success is dependent on the success of our people. We are the world's travel platform, made up of the most knowledgeable, passionate, and creative people in our business. Our brands recognize the power of travel to break down barriers and make people's lives better – that responsibility inspires us to be the place where exceptional people want to do their best work, and to provide them the tools to do so.

Whether you're applying to work in engineering or customer support, marketing or lodging supply, at Expedia Group we act as one team, working towards a common goal; to bring the world within reach. We relentlessly strive for better, but not at the cost of the customer. We act with humility and optimism, respecting ideas big and small. We value diversity and voices of all volumes. We are a global organization but keep our feet on the ground, so we can act fast and stay simple. Our teams also have the chance to give back on a local level and make a difference through our corporate social responsibility program, Expedia Cares.

If you have a hunger to make a difference with one of the most loved consumer brands in the world and to work in the dynamic travel industry, this is the job for you.

Our family of travel brands includes: Brand Expedia®, Hotels.com®, Expedia® Partner Solutions, Egencia®, trivago®, HomeAway®, Orbitz®, Travelocity®, Wotif®, lastminute.com.au®, ebookers®, CheapTickets®, Hotwire®, Classic Vacations®, Expedia® Media Solutions, CarRentals.comTM, Expedia Local Expert®, Expedia® CruiseShipCenters®, SilverRail Technologies, Inc., ALICE and Traveldoo®.

#LI-MW3

Expedia is committed to creating an inclusive work environment with a diverse workforce.All qualified applicants will receive consideration for employment without regard to race, religion, gender, sexual orientation, national origin, disability or age.

About Expedia

We are the world's travel platform. Bringing the world within reach.

View Website

Get More Interviews for This and Many Other Jobs

Huntr helps you instantly craft tailored resumes and cover letters, fill out application forms with a single click, effortlessly keep your job hunt organized, and much more.

Sign Up for Free